Abstract A procedure for generating sequences of LP_τvectors that are uniformly distributed in the multi-dimensional unit cube is presented here together with its implementation in ANSI-C. The high performance and the efficiency of the generating algorithm make sequences of LP_τvectors preferable to cope with some problems traditionally associated with Monte Carlo methods. Title of program: LPTAU Catalogue Id: ACPO_v1_0 Nature of problem Any physical problem where solution can be found in the process of Monte Carlo simulation. Multi-criteria decision making. Optimization problems and quasi-random search.
